An object experiences an impulse, moves and attains a momentum of 100 kg·m/s. If its mass is 50 kg, what would its velocity be?

Its velocity would be 2 m/s. Momentum is mass times velocity, so the reverse would show one or the other. 100/50 is 2, so the answer is 2 m/s.
